Output 672c5d7a6d1c3018d8e7fbafe37e63958fd47d174b89f60e797817592e0feccf:0

value
499060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d39bec2a5ded416e3d45c6e38eef5b8afd16b9d OP_EQUAL
address
32twtExSzRs3Pv3wXXcLLi8tgv8NJk2HPE
transaction
672c5d7a6d1c3018d8e7fbafe37e63958fd47d174b89f60e797817592e0feccf
spent
true